log PHP non ignorerà ripetuto gli errori con ignore_repeated_errors = On
-
21-09-2019 - |
Domanda
Anche se ho dato istruzioni php per registrare solo una volta un errore - vedo l'errore più e più volte nel mio file di log. Tutte le idee perché questa direttiva sarebbe ottenere ignorati? Ho riavviato apache, ecc.
Soluzione
Questa direttiva si fermerà solo l'errore di essere connesso nuovamente all'interno dello stesso script eseguito . Quando lo stesso script viene eseguito più volte, si continua a vedere che di errore ogni volta.
Altri suggerimenti
Oltre al ignore_repeated_errors
, c'è anche le impostazioni ini ignore_repeated_source
. Penso che si potrebbe lavorare per voi e dovrebbe interrompere la visualizzazione di volte, quando lo stesso file si chiama più e più volte lo stesso errore.
Come PHP manuale href="http://php.net/manual/en/errorfunc.configuration.php#ini.ignore-repeated-source" qui dice per esso:
ignore_repeated_source
- Ignora fonte di messaggio quando ignora i messaggi ripetuti. Quando questo impostazione è On non si registrare gli errori con i messaggi ripetuti i file o le differenti linee